How body temperature affects sleep quality

Your core body temperature naturally lowers before sleep. If your sleepwear or environment prevents this drop, it can delay sleep and cause frequent awakenings. Overheating reduces REM sleep and leaves you feeling unrested. Maintaining an ideal sleep temperature (typically 60-67°F or 15-19°C) is vital for achieving deep, uninterrupted rest, and appropriate sleepwear is a primary tool to achieve this essential physiological state for better rest.

Bamboo: The sustainable cooling champion

Bamboo fabric (often rayon or lyocell) is an outstanding choice for hot sleepers. It's incredibly soft, lightweight, and boasts superior moisture-wicking capabilities, drawing sweat away from your skin for rapid evaporation. This quick moisture transfer creates a pronounced cooling sensation and aids in thermoregulation. Its natural breathability and sustainability make bamboo a top contender for the best sleepwear fabric for sleep.

Cotton and Silk: Breathable classics for comfort

Cotton remains popular for sleepwear due to its breathability and absorbency; lighter weaves like percale are best for hot sleepers. Silk, despite its luxury, is an excellent temperature regulator, with smooth fibers that wick moisture without feeling damp. Both offer natural comfort and heat regulation, making them strong choices depending on your preference for feel and value in the search for the best sleepwear fabric for sleep.

Modal: A breathable semi-synthetic alternative

Modal, a semi-synthetic rayon fiber derived from beechwood pulp, is an excellent cooling synthetic option. It's exceptionally soft, smoother than cotton, and notably more breathable. Modal excels at moisture-wicking, efficiently pulling sweat away from the skin, and resists pilling, ensuring durability. Its superior breathability and moisture management make modal a top choice for hot sleepers seeking a comfortable and effective cooling fabric option.

The importance of weave: Percale vs. sateen

For fabrics like cotton, the weave is paramount. Percale is a plain weave, creating a crisp, matte finish with excellent breathability and a cool feel—ideal for hot sleepers due to its open structure. In contrast, sateen features a tighter weave, offering a smoother, silkier feel but often trapping more heat. Choosing percale cotton sleepwear provides superior airflow and a distinct cooling sensation, crucial for those who easily overheat at night.

Moisture-wicking vs. absorbency

Understanding the distinction between moisture-wicking and absorbency is critical. Absorbent fabrics, like traditional cotton, soak up sweat and hold it, potentially leading to a damp, clammy feeling. Moisture-wicking fabrics, conversely, actively pull moisture away from your skin to the fabric's exterior for rapid evaporation. This process keeps your skin dry and creates a cooling effect. For hot sleepers, moisture-wicking properties are generally superior to simple absorbency, found in materials like bamboo and advanced synthetics.

Loose fits and strategic ventilation

The fit and design of your sleepwear are crucial for cooling. Tight-fitting garments restrict airflow and trap heat. Always opt for loose-fitting styles that allow air to circulate freely around your skin, such as wide necklines, shorts, or sleeveless designs. Strategic ventilation, including mesh panels in key areas or open-back constructions, further enhances airflow and heat dissipation. These design elements work in tandem with fabric choice to keep you comfortably cool all night.
